there have been some changes to the calendar since Caesar, especially when people went to bed Thursday 4 October 1582 and woke up on Friday 15 October 1582, and thereafter there were no more leap years on centuries except every 400 years.

One fun historical tidbit is that St Teresa of Ávila died on the night of the 4th to the 15th of October, 1582.
